Is their any way to configure new datbase for spark-sql in hdp 2.6

Will you please please help me to configure new database.


By default the spark-sql is connecting to the hive, so i want to configure new database like postgreSQL instead of hive

Spark SQL data source can read data from other databases using JDBC.JDBC connection properties such as user and password are normally provided as connection properties for logging into the data sources.

In the example below I am using MySQL, so will need to have the Postgres drivers in place

Sample Program

import org.apache.spark.sql.SQLContext
val sqlcontext = new org.apache.spark.sql.SQLContext(sc)
val dataframe_mysql = sqlcontext.read.format("jdbc").option("url", "jdbc:mysql://mbarara.com:3306/test").option("driver", "com.mysql.jdbc.Driver").option("dbtable", "emp").option("user", "root").option("password", "welcome1").load()
dataframe_mysql.show()
